Output 93c3bb300e118e731f89b95b518060c8c8a4d2c84b6385ac249583765bcab882:1

value
1587000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18ca4f37ad9e6ce3146e0a85a8f939fe5c9fa04e OP_EQUAL
address
33x6VrVuawyWT432v2CGsHSb2nk7nZwuXE
transaction
93c3bb300e118e731f89b95b518060c8c8a4d2c84b6385ac249583765bcab882
spent
true